# Soft deletes — orders table (Marrowline)

Orders are never hard-deleted. Setting deleted_at marks a row; the reaper job purges after the retention window. Do not run manual DELETEs. Restores: clear deleted_at within the window, then reindex. The reaper reads its thresholds from the service config at startup, reproduced below for reference.

service settings:
[casax]
port = 6379
team = rusir
host = casax.zemvarhq.corp
region = outer-4
access_code = ac_9808ce
timeout_ms = 1500

### Circuit Breaker Configuration

The Lanternworks gateway wraps all calls to the upstream Fernvale pricing API in a circuit breaker. When five consecutive requests fail within a ten-second window, the breaker opens and the gateway serves cached quotes for sixty seconds before attempting a half-open probe. New team members should note that breaker state is reported to the internal Pulseboard metrics service, and every state transition must be authenticated. Configure your local gateway instance with the Pulseboard key provided below.

service key, tadup-tahog: zpat7_wB1tnEL

Runbook: Pick-list optimizer (Cartwheel). Before approving changes to the routing heuristics, verify the benchmark suite ran against the full Dellbrook warehouse layout, not the reduced fixture — the reduced fixture hides aisle-congestion regressions. Also confirm the fallback to static pick order still triggers on solver timeout. Benchmark procedure and acceptance thresholds are listed on the internal page below:

operations page: https://confluence.qorvellabs.internal/pages/projects/projects/projects

Ferrowynd alleges that our Lumetra controller incorporates firmware covered by their expired licence terms; our counsel disagrees, citing the renegotiated 2019 schedule. Negotiations have stalled over royalty retroactivity. We have paused Lumetra shipments to two distributors as a precaution while maintaining production. Counsel recommends a settlement offer before arbitration deadlines close next quarter. Full correspondence and legal opinions are filed with the secretariat. A confidential note on our related business plans appears below.

board note of bajop-yaweg: The western region missed its Pelys quota by 58.0 percent last quarter. Pelysek Foods plans to raise the Belius list price by 44.0 percent in July. The steering committee signed off on a budget of $133.8 million for Project Pelax. The renewal with Zoraelix Systems closes at $61.9 million a year, 12.7 percent above the last contract.